ORA-03001,GATHER_TABLE_STATS数据库自动收集统计信息报错

2.文档搜索

由于在生产环境,并未直接手工收集统计信息进行测试
根据报错,匹配到了一个Mos文档
ORA-: Unimplemented Feature when Running DBMS_STATS.GATHER_INDEX_STATS (文档 ID 559389.1)   

3.问题分析

测试环境进行测试

5.问题处理

按照MOS的文档,对该索引删除后,新建的索引第二列修改为字符格式,本次测试验证,修改为字符格式后,该索引的使用是否与修改前相同,不会造成性能问题。

此索引的创建意义,在于如果查询is null,通过索引能够取得结果

结论:1.对索引drop 后,重建索引,

CREATE INDEX "HR"."LCCONT_INDEX_VDATE1" ON "HR"."LCCONT" ("VISITDATE",'1')
2.重建索引并不会影像sql的执行选择,从原理上说,此类索引的目的是让索引能存储单列的Null值,使得业务Is null能够使用此索引,至于第二列的数值类型并不关心
